This pioneering book compares public administration in two distinct countries to examine the development of a new form of bureaucratisation. Taking a mixed-method empirical approach, Karl Lofgren and Patrik Hall explore the differences and commonalities in this intriguing global phenomenon.The New Public Bureaucracy investigates the growing number of organisational professionals whose primary role is the management of internal functions, such as quality control, audits, performance review and organisational branding. The book examines and verifies this growth by drawing on public sector workforce data and case studies from New Zealand and Sweden concerning transport agencies, police forces and higher education sectors. Lofgren and Hall also identify patterns of growing attention to accountability through the expansion of managerialism, politicisation and professionalisation. They explain the development of a new type of bureaucratisation as the result of the tension between politics and public administration.This book is an essential resource for students and academics in management, human resources and public administration.
